Quality of life, life after surgery
An artificial joint is designed to withstand everyday stresses. Sporting activities within the usual scope are fine. Strenuous physical activities involving jarring or jolting (e.g. shock-like impacts, jumping) which expose the prosthesis to knocks and/or excessive strain (e.g. strenuous physical work, marathon runs, etc.) can affect the success of the operation.For further informations please ask your doctor.
